hello,

i have just bought a 2000 1.6 golf mk4. there is a problem with the microswitch on the front passenger door. when i open it, the interior lights and door light do not come on, yet all the other doors work.

on other cars you can see the switch near the hinge of the door, play with it and itll start working. im struggling to find the microswitch on these doors so i can spray some wd40 in it.

i have found some threads concerning this issue, but couldnt find one that is descriptive on which part to use wd40 on.

if anyone can give me some pointers it would be much appreciated, also if you have any better ideas than wd40.. please share :p

when i lock the car using my button on the drivers door, the whole car locks and the passenger door unlocks straight away. i presume this is all due to the microswitch.. ??
